Output 08bc0ca846a0a49db8856241814228c11362ae756bc8990a33fd85cb401d6a08:27

value
143978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9019cdcab6658e61aa0cccf7e1313c8aa1d48535 OP_EQUAL
address
3Epx93y3RoCMdFmT6JLj2mgCX3qrp8sGZ3
transaction
08bc0ca846a0a49db8856241814228c11362ae756bc8990a33fd85cb401d6a08
confirmations
193480
spent
true